About
Key skills and expertise.
Bringing over 30 years of experience in public financial management, economic governance, and policy development, the expert has spent at least 16 years specializing in public finance management. Career highlights include leading 23 team leader assignments and providing advisory services on economic reforms and capacity building. Responsibilities have included managing complex international projects and delivering quantifiable results in diverse environments. The expert has demonstrated proven leadership in establishing public financial control systems and implementing Medium-Term Expenditure Frameworks, contributing significantly to anti-corruption initiatives and governance improvements.
Project experience and donor exposure.
The expert has extensive experience working with international donors, including the European Union, USAID, the British Embassy, Adam Smith International, and the World Bank. In these collaborations, the expert has been involved in project implementation, technical assistance, evaluations, and capacity building. Thematic areas of focus have included governance, public finance management, infrastructure, and anti-corruption. Projects have been conducted on both national and regional scales in countries such as Libya, Iraq, Syria, Turkey, Montenegro, and Ukraine. The expert's work has often involved advising Ministries of Finance and playing a pivotal role in public administration reforms and economic development strategies.
Sectors and geographic focus.
With a background in sectors such as macro-economics, public finance, procurement, monitoring and evaluation, finance and accounting, and audit, the expert has held roles as a team leader, advisor, and consultant. Responsibilities have included project implementation, policy development, and capacity building. The expert's interdisciplinary knowledge spans public investment management, economic reforms, and anti-corruption initiatives. Work has been conducted on regional and country-specific levels, particularly in EU candidate and transition economies, providing a comprehensive understanding of diverse governance and economic contexts. The expert has extensive geographic experience across Europe, the Middle East, and North America, having worked in countries such as Albania, Azerbaijan, Bosnia and Herzegovina, Bulgaria, Croatia, Cyprus, Czech Republic, Georgia, Greece, Iraq, Libya, North Macedonia, Serbia, Slovakia, Syria, Turkey, Turkmenistan, Ukraine, and the USA. This broad exposure has provided deep familiarity with local governance and regional development issues, particularly in EU candidate and transition economies, where the expert has frequently engaged in long-term assignments and advisory roles.
Languages and education.
Fluent in English and Greek, the expert has effectively utilized language skills in diverse professional settings, including international projects and collaborations with multilingual teams across various countries. This linguistic capability has supported roles in advising, consulting, and leading international initiatives in numerous regions. The expert holds a Ph.D. in Economics from Fordham University, USA, and an MA in European Integration with a dual major in Trade and Finance from the University of Reading, UK. Additionally, a BA (Hons) in Economics was obtained from the Economic University of Athens, Greece. These academic credentials underpin the expert's extensive career in economic and financial sectors.
